Intermediate care facility for persons with developmental disabilities means a facility where shelter, food, and training or habilitation services, advice, counseling, diagnosis, treatment, care, nursing care, or related services are provided for a period of more than twenty-four consecutive hours to four or more persons residing at such facility who have a developmental disability.
Neb. Rev. Stat. § 71-421
Intermediate care facility for persons with developmental disabilities, defined
Laws 2000, LB 819, § 21; Laws 2013, LB23, § 27.
